From behind, a woman in a flowing white off-shoulder ballgown and long white gloves holds an open book, her auburn waves falling down her bare back against a warm glowing copper background that feels like candlelight made permanent. The painting is quiet in the way a Sunday morning is quiet — full, unhurried, entirely its own. She could be reading anything. She is probably reading something that wrecked her. A love letter to readers, painted for the walls of people who understand that a book is never just a book.
